Howard saw action in seven games this season, averaging 3.0 points and 1.1 rebounds with the Heat in 2012-13.
ANALYSIS
Howard was available for the third straight season to fill a roster spot for the Heat after two 10-day contracts turned into the rest of the season. At age 40, his days of regular playing time are over, and he will become an unrestricted free agent on July 1. If he plays another season, it will likely be a similar situation of catching on midseason to be a veteran filling a bench spot.

Howard, a 38-year-old veteran big man, will return to the Heat this season after appearing in 57 games last year. He averaged 2.4 PPG, 2.1 rebounds and will look to provide depth off the bench for Miami.
Some were surprised to hear Howard was still in the league, but as an injury replacement in Portland last season, he showed he still has some game. He’ll be a veteran depth player for Miami, unlikely to get much playing time unless Bosh or Haslem is injured.
Howard's role with Minnesota is unclear as he heads into the 2007-08 season. He was traded to Minnesota this offseason from Houston for Mike James and Justin Reed with Howard signing off on the deal due to the promise of playing with Kevin Garnett. With KG gone, Howard now faces the prospect of little playing time as the rebuilding T-Wolves look to give younger players a shot. Expect Minnesota to work hard to trade the $14 million left on his six-year, $36.9 million contract.
Howard was the only constant on last season's Rockets' team, and that's not saying much. He'll again be the Rockets starting power forward, logging close to 30 minutes per game, but he's the fourth or fifth option in the offense and isn't much of a rebounder for a four (6.7 rpg a year ago). Howard will shoot a decent percentage from the floor and the line, but there's virtually no upside here.

Howard shouldn't have much trouble beating out Mo Taylor for the starting spot in Houston, and he won't get much attention from opposing defenses - not with Tracy McGrady and Yao Ming on the floor. He won't score many points as a third option, but should put up solid numbers across the board.
Howard won't be counted on to be the main scoring option for the Magic - a role that is delegated to Tracy McGrady. This could prove to be a blessing for Howard as defenses will key on McGrady, leaving his job a much easier task. Howard will get most of the minutes at power forward and maybe a few at center when the Magic go to a smaller lineup.
